    One of the better experiences I've had with a car rental company. People should always mention in their review the day/time they book because huge variables come into play depending on the day most notably in regards to wait times. My rental was from tuesday-thursday last week of august. I had reserved my car after finding the cheapest one in the area a month ahead of time. I periodically searched again as prices are known to fluctuate. Luckily, I was able to save another $20 on my two-day rental by rebooking a week beforehand. And this was already half the price of what it would cost at PDX airport. I think I may just rent near city centers and just uber or public transport myself from the airport going forward. Anyway, my reservation was for noon and there were a couple workers and couple other customers getting taken care of. I waited for a few minutes until someone became available and I believe his name was Ryan. He was very cordial and helpful. I think I've become paranoid when renting a car because of stories of hidden fees and being coaxed into upgrades and pre-paying for fuel. Ryan wasn't pushy and I asked him straight if there were any fees or anything I had to worry about when signing my documents. He told me not to worry. He also gave me some choices of vehicles to drive, one of which was a dodge charger! Mind you, I chose the economy (cheapest) vehicle when I booked and this def wasn't in the same price range. Again, being very skeptical, I asked how much more before getting too excited. He told me there was no surcharge and my rate would cover this car. I then happily obliged. We did a quick survey of the car for damages and I did notice some dings here and there that I brought to his attention and again he calmed my nerves by explaining that they needed to be about 2 inches long for it to be worth noting. When I returned the car, I knew I would unlikely be dealing with Ryan again and I was right. There were other employees at my return. Again, I was getting anxious whether they would charge me for something obscure or the dings that were previously there. But everything went smoothly and I was happy with my experience. I think I need to relax a little bit more when renting a car, but I do think most of the anxiety comes form airport car rentals that can be pushy and aggressive and where you are more likely to be swindled. This Enterprise has definitely impressed me and I will looking be at their services first. At least at this location, I know I will be treated well.

    Renting cars is annoying with the price fluctuations based on location. It pays to hunt for the best rate in town. Sometimes the gouging at the airport is not worth it. For my trip, downtown locations were more expensive. This location had the cheapest rates and just a short distance from Chinatown across the Burnside bridge. I took a quick look and it looks like this one is more expensive now! Portland's easy to get around via train/bus and lyft. But if you want to visit Multnomah Falls you need a car! This location happens to be a few blocks away from Nong's restaurant and Le Pigeon. I decided to hit up Pine State Biscuits before hand since they're not on the downtown side. The parking lot was jammed full of cars and can be hard to back out of on a ordinary day. But with packed snow causing bad traction - it was intimidating. They don't offer snow chains on rentals and the nearby auto parts store was gouging them for $120 pair with no returns. Thankfully modern cars have traction control and ABS standard nowadays. The rep said it should be okay to drive but to be careful and give lots of room. Almost got the car ice stuck in a street parking spot. Eventually the tires bit hard enough and the car lurched off the ice pack. I did see many cars sliding around on the streets, mangled cars, and one nearly spun in front of me on the highway. After years of racing and spinning - even Portland's ice conditions were more treacherous! Definitely recommend inspecting your car well with the staff before leaving. Portland is notorious for rocks causing windshield and paint damage. My car had a preexisting bullseye in the windshield. When I went to return the car - they strongly suggested I return it to the location in downtown. I suspect downtown locations always needs cars and the staff at this location didn't want to add another to their overcrowded lot. Ask before hand and save yourself an extra errand. Overall this location was budget friendly and fairly hassle free. Not nearly the awful experience other reviews have mentioned.

    First time renting with Dollar Car Rental. Worked out really well (like everything else with our…read morePortland trip). I'm completely aware that car rental car companies are pretty much the same, with price being the most important factor. And the price can vary greatly based on the platform you use to book the order. Another important factor are the rewards gained (like it is for any other credit card purchase). And of course, they are out to make a buck, so incentivize their employees to upsell (insurance, prepay gas, accessories), along with adding on various mandatory surcharges (hidden amongst the myriad of government taxes and fees). So as of this moment, here are the rules I try to follow. -- It matters what platform one books it through. Selection of cars within a class doesn't really matter to me. Prices can vary. Some require prepayment while others pay at time of rental. Never use a third party company specializing in car rentals (e.g. wisecars). And will no longer use car sharing platforms like Turo: too risky. -- Always decline insurance (liability insurance is already included in price; comprehensive/collision can come from credit card used or your home auto insurance policy). Prebuying gas can save you money if you drive the car down to empty. I've learned that is something I no longer have any interest in doing. So now always look for a nearby Costco to fill up before returning. -- loyalty rewards tied to the rental car company itself is irrelevant. That's why rental car company points aren't even tracked as having any value, like airline miles or credit card company points are. In fact, some companies will tack on additional fees if you give them your airline frequent flyer number to get additional points. -- unless one must require a certain number of seats or feature (e.g. a minivan to seat 7, a convertible or 4x4 for Hawaii), getting a compact to intermediate works for us. And in many cases, they will upgrade you to a full size for free (cause that's what is available). -- Using the Chase Sapphire Reserve credit card as the sole payment method because it provided PRIMARY car rental insurance. This is important for me since any damage to the rental car would be handled by Chase first, before your private insurance would.. Chase made a big change on the Sapphire Reserve card where rental car are now only 1% back (unless prepaid on the Chase Travel site, where it is 8% back). -- Reputable Sites to check (this is where a multi-tab, multi-screen set-up helps. No longer use Google) -- Costco Travel (Avis, Alamo, Budget, Enterprise) - 5% back (2% executive). Pay later. -- Delta Cars and Stays (uses the Expedia platform) - 2% back in miles, sometimes gives 1:1 MQDs. Pay later. -- Chase Travel - prepaid. 8% back. But have always found them to be more expensive, but would choose this if competitive. -- Citi Travel - 10% back, but would have to use different card. -- Kayak - just to see what it out there. Ended up booking with Delta, getting a compact for two days for $68. I don't remember the last time getting such a low rate.
